Output 0406e326dd380042c27804c30c76cde214a0f5b768891b08c5ee2ac5d13bac23:4

value
25329462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dc1ac62cc9077a32c82bf7e872ea1e700b5ecd8 OP_EQUAL
address
MGSu5w4h21jFBbj2V1J7b1aRKSzCBqnwBT
transaction
0406e326dd380042c27804c30c76cde214a0f5b768891b08c5ee2ac5d13bac23
spent
true